How to fill out running a school gardening?
01
Plan the layout: Determine the size and location of the garden, and plan out the different areas for planting, composting, and outdoor learning spaces.
02
Prepare the soil: Test the soil and amend it as needed to ensure it is fertile and suitable for plant growth. Clear any weeds or debris from the area.
03
Choose the plants: Decide what types of plants you want to grow in the garden based on your climate, available space, and educational goals. Consider incorporating a mix of vegetables, fruits, herbs, and flowers.
04
Obtain necessary materials: Gather tools, seeds, seedlings, and other materials required for gardening. Consider reaching out to local nurseries, gardening centers, and community organizations for support and donations.
05
Involve students and staff: Encourage students and staff to participate in the planning, planting, and maintenance of the school garden. Organize gardening clubs, assign responsibilities, and provide necessary training and guidance.
06
Implement sustainable practices: Incorporate eco-friendly practices such as composting, rainwater harvesting, and natural pest control methods. Teach students about the importance of sustainability and its impact on the environment.
07
Create educational opportunities: Utilize the school garden as a hands-on learning environment. Develop lesson plans and activities that connect gardening to various subjects such as science, math, art, and nutrition.
08
Regular maintenance: Establish a schedule for watering, weeding, and maintaining the garden. Encourage students to take ownership of their areas and teach them how to care for the plants properly.
09
Harvest and enjoy: Once the plants are ready for harvest, involve students in picking and using their produce. Consider organizing cooking classes, taste tests, or donating excess food to local food banks.
10
Evaluate and improve: Continually assess the effectiveness of the school garden program and make necessary adjustments. Seek feedback from students, parents, and staff to enhance the educational and community impact of the garden.
